Contents:
Acknowledgments -- Why Critical Vehicles? -- 1. Destinations -- Designing for the City of Strangers (1997) -- Interrogative Design (1994) -- Beyond the Hybrid State? (1992) -- Avant-Garde as Public Art: The Future of a Tradition (1984) -- For the De-Incapacitation of the Avant-Garde in Canada (1983) -- 2. Projections -- Public Projection (1983) -- Memorial Projection (1986) -- The Venice Projections (1986) -- The Homeless Projection: A Proposal for the City of New York (1986) -- Projection on the Monument to Friedrich II, Kassel (1987) -- City Hall Tower Illumination, Philadelphia (1987) -- Speaking through Monuments (1988) -- City Hall Tower Projection, Krakow (1996) -- Voices of the Tower (1996) -- 3. Vehicles -- Vehicle (1971-73) -- Vehicles (1977-79) -- Homeless Vehicle Project (1988-89) -- Conversations about a Project for a Homeless Vehicle (1988) -- Poliscar (1991) -- 4. Instruments -- The Personal Instrument (1969) -- Alien Staff (Xenobacul) (1992) -- Alien Staff, Variant 2 (1992-93) -- Voices of the Alien Staff (1992-96) -- Identity and Community: Alien Staff (1994) -- The Mouthpiece (Porte-Parole) (1993) -- The Mouthpiece, Variants (1995-97) -- Voices of the Mouthpiece (1994-96) -- Xenology: Immigrant Instruments (1996) -- AEgis: Equipment for a City of Strangers (1998) -- 5. Questions -- A Response to the New Museum (1991) -- A Response to Maria Morzuch (1992) -- A Conversation with October (1986) -- An Interview by Roger Gilroy (1989) -- An Interview by Jean-Christophe Royoux (1992) -- An Interview by Bruce W. Ferguson (1991) -- An Interview by Bruce Robbins (1996) -- An Interview by Jaromir Jedlinski (1997) -- Bookshelf.
